NICK'S PIZZA

1006 E ALTAMONTE DR STE 1001

Overall Food Safety Rating

★★½☆☆ (2.5/5)
Based on 4 health inspection reports

All Inspection Reports

Inspection Date: 1/17/2025

Inspection #: Visit ID: 8830781

  • 29-08-4:Basic - Plumbing system in disrepair. -cold water knob does not work at hand wash sink. Repeat Violation
  • 25-05-4:Basic - Single-service articles improperly stored. -to go boxes, paper goods stored in restroom. -unfolded pizza boxes on floor next to hand wash sink.
  • 02D-01-5:Basic - Working containers of food removed from original container not identified by common name. -flour, salt containers in back hallway not labeled. Corrected On-Site

Inspection Date: 7/16/2024

Inspection #: Visit ID: 8779933

  • 29-08-4:Basic - Plumbing system in disrepair. -no cold water at hand wash sink. Repeat Violation
  • 25-05-4:Basic - Single-service articles improperly stored. -napkins, to go containers stored in restroom.
  • 09-01-4:High Priority - Employee touching ready-to-eat food with their bare hands - food was not being heated as a sole ingredient to 145 degrees F or immediately added to other ingredients to be cooked/heated to the minimum required temperature to allow bare hand contact. Establishment has no approved Alternative Operating Procedure. -employee touched edge of cooked pizza with bare hands. Educated. **Corrective Action Taken**
  • 11-26-1:Intermediate - No proof provided that food employees are informed of their responsibility to report to the person in charge information about their health and activities related to foodborne illnesses. -1 new employee. Printed copy in Spanish, employee signed. Corrected On-Site
  • 02C-02-5:Intermediate - 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food prepared onsite and held more than 24 hours not properly date marked. -sautéed spinach prepared approximately 4 days ago per operator has old date mark of 7/2. Recommend operator add new date mark.
